Management of acute food protein-induced enterocolitis syndrome emergencies at home and in a medical facility.
Leonard, SA, Miceli Sopo, S, Baker, MG, Fiocchi, A, Wood, RA, Nowak-Węgrzyn, A
Annals of allergy, asthma & immunology : official publication of the American College of Allergy, Asthma, & Immunology. 2021;(5):482-488.e1
Abstract
OBJECTIVE Acute food protein-induced enterocolitis syndrome (FPIES) is characterized by delayed repetitive vomiting after ingestion of a trigger food, and severe reactions may lead to dehydration, hypotension, and shock. We provide recommendations on management of FPIES emergencies in a medical facility and at home. DATA SOURCES This review summarizes the literature on clinical context, pathophysiology, presentation, and treatment of FPIES emergencies. STUDY SELECTIONS We referred to the 2017 International Consensus Guidelines for the Diagnosis and Management of FPIES and performed a literature search identifying relevant recent primary articles and review articles on clinical management. RESULTS Management of FPIES emergencies in a medical facility is based on severity of symptoms and involves rehydration, ondansetron, and corticosteroids. A proactive approach for reactions occurring at home involves prescribing oral ondansetron and providing an individualized treatment plan based on the evolution of symptoms and severity of past reactions. A better understanding of the pathophysiology of FPIES and randomized trials on ondansedron and cocorticosteroid use could lead to more targeted treatments. CONCLUSION Children with FPIES are at risk for severe symptoms constituting a medical emergency. Management of FPIES emergencies is largely supportive, with treatment tailored to the symptoms, severity of the patient's condition, location of reaction, and reaction history.

Adjunctive treatments for the management of septic shock - a narrative review of the current evidence.
Donovan, K, Shah, A, Day, J, McKechnie, SR
Anaesthesia. 2021;(9):1245-1258
-
-
Free full text
-
Abstract
Septic shock is a leading cause of death and morbidity worldwide. The cornerstones of management include prompt identification of sepsis, early initiation of antibiotic therapy, adequate fluid resuscitation and organ support. Over the past two decades, there have been considerable improvements in our understanding of the pathophysiology of sepsis and the host response, including regulation of inflammation, endothelial disruption and impaired immunity. This has offered opportunities for innovative adjunctive treatments such as vitamin C, corticosteroids and beta-blockers. Some of these approaches have shown promising results in early phase trials in humans, while others, such as corticosteroids, have been tested in large, international, multicentre randomised controlled trials. Contemporary guidelines make a weak recommendation for the use of corticosteroids to reduce mortality in sepsis and septic shock. Vitamin C, despite showing initial promise in observational studies, has so far not been shown to be clinically effective in randomised trials. Beta-blocker therapy may have beneficial cardiac and non-cardiac effects in septic shock, but there is currently insufficient evidence to recommend their use for this condition. The results of ongoing randomised trials are awaited. Crucial to reducing heterogeneity in the trials of new sepsis treatments will be the concept of enrichment, which refers to the purposive selection of patients with clinical and biological characteristics that are likely to be responsive to the intervention being tested.

Intraoperative Applications of Topical Corticosteroid Therapy for Chronic Rhinosinusitis.
Lelegren, MJ, Bloch, RA, Lam, KK
Ear, nose, & throat journal. 2021;(5):320-328
-
-
Free full text
-
Abstract
OBJECTIVES To provide an overview of recent techniques and technologies for the application of topical corticosteroid therapy immediately following endoscopic sinus surgery (ESS) for chronic rhinosinusitis (CRS). METHODS A comprehensive search in the PubMed and Google Scholar databases was conducted to identify publications between January 2000 and December 2019 detailing clinical trials that have evaluated the efficacy and safety of intraoperative applications of topical corticosteroids for CRS. RESULTS A total of 21 articles, all of which highlight a variety of corticosteroid-infused products, including Propel corticosteroid-eluting stents, NasoPore, Merocel, SinuBand, calcium alginate, and bioresorbable gel-type products, are included for review. Propel stents are the only devices that have achieved level 1A evidence in terms of efficacy and have data to support their safety. The remaining products have shown mixed results in terms of efficacy and safety. CONCLUSION A wide range of techniques and technologies have been introduced to enhance the topical delivery of corticosteroids into the neosinuses after ESS for CRS. Regarding efficacy, there is level 1A evidence to support the use of Propel stents. Most of the remaining strategies show some degree of efficacy. Direct comparisons across the different strategies are limited owing to the varied uses of delivery vectors, corticosteroid choices, and doses of corticosteroids. Propel stents and SinuBand have sufficient data to support systemic and ocular safety, whereas the remaining products have limited data to support their safety.

AIRE Gene Mutation Presenting at Age 2 Years With Autoimmune Retinopathy and Steroid-Responsive Acute Liver Failure: A Case Report and Literature Review.
Sakaguchi, H, Mizuochi, T, Haruta, M, Takase, R, Yoshida, S, Yamashita, Y, Nishikomori, R
Frontiers in immunology. 2021;:687280
Abstract
Autoimmune polyendocrinopathy-candidiasis-ectodermal dystrophy (APECED) is a rare monogenic autosomal recessive disorder caused by mutation in the autoimmune regulator (AIRE) gene. Patients usually are diagnosed at ages between 5 and 15 years when they show 3 or more manifestations, most typically mucocutaneous candidiasis, Addison's disease, and hypoparathyroidism. APECED-associated hepatitis (APAH) develops in only 10% to 40% of patients, with severity varying from subclinical chronic active hepatitis to potentially fatal acute liver failure (ALF). Ocular abnormalities are fairly common, most often keratopathy but sometimes retinopathy. Here we report a 2-year-old Japanese girl with an AIRE gene mutation who developed APAH with ALF, preceded by autoimmune retinopathy associated with anti-recoverin antibody before major symptoms suggested a diagnosis of APECED. Intravenous pulse methylprednisolone therapy followed by a corticosteroid combined with azathioprine treatment resolved ALF and achieved control of APAH. To our knowledge, our patient is the youngest reported to have ALF resulting from an AIRE gene mutation. Pulse methylprednisolone induction therapy followed by treatment with corticosteroid plus azathioprine may well be effective in other children with APAH and AIRE gene mutations.

Autoimmune encephalitis: proposed best practice recommendations for diagnosis and acute management.
Abboud, H, Probasco, JC, Irani, S, Ances, B, Benavides, DR, Bradshaw, M, Christo, PP, Dale, RC, Fernandez-Fournier, M, Flanagan, EP, et al
Journal of neurology, neurosurgery, and psychiatry. 2021;(7):757-768
-
-
Free full text
-
Abstract
The objective of this paper is to evaluate available evidence for each step in autoimmune encephalitis management and provide expert opinion when evidence is lacking. The paper approaches autoimmune encephalitis as a broad category rather than focusing on individual antibody syndromes. Core authors from the Autoimmune Encephalitis Alliance Clinicians Network reviewed literature and developed the first draft. Where evidence was lacking or controversial, an electronic survey was distributed to all members to solicit individual responses. Sixty-eight members from 17 countries answered the survey. Corticosteroids alone or combined with other agents (intravenous IG or plasmapheresis) were selected as a first-line therapy by 84% of responders for patients with a general presentation, 74% for patients presenting with faciobrachial dystonic seizures, 63% for NMDAR-IgG encephalitis and 48.5% for classical paraneoplastic encephalitis. Half the responders indicated they would add a second-line agent only if there was no response to more than one first-line agent, 32% indicated adding a second-line agent if there was no response to one first-line agent, while only 15% indicated using a second-line agent in all patients. As for the preferred second-line agent, 80% of responders chose rituximab while only 10% chose cyclophosphamide in a clinical scenario with unknown antibodies. Detailed survey results are presented in the manuscript and a summary of the diagnostic and therapeutic recommendations is presented at the conclusion.

Pharmacological treatments for eosinophilic esophagitis: current options and emerging therapies.
Lucendo, AJ
Expert review of clinical immunology. 2020;(1):63-77
Abstract
Introduction: The epidemiology of eosinophilic esophagitis (EoE) has increased rapidly to represent a common cause of chronic and recurrent esophageal symptoms. Current treatment options have limitations so the development of novel therapies is a matter of growing interest.Areas covered: This article provides an up-to-date discussion of current therapies and investigational options for EoE. Established anti-inflammatory treatments for EoE at present include dietary therapy, proton pump inhibitors and swallowed topic steroids, which should be combined with endoscopic dilation in case of strictures. Refractoriness, high recurrence rates, and need for long-term therapies have promoted the investigation of novel, esophageal-targeted formulas of topic corticosteroids, and monoclonal antibodies (including mepolizumab, reslizumab, QAX576, RPC4046, dupilumab, omalizumab, infliximab, and vedolizumab) for EoE, with some having been demonstrated as effective and safe in the short term. Several additional promising therapies are also discussed.Expert opinion: Several therapeutic targets have shown efficacy and will be approved to treat EoE, especially corticosteroid-sparing options and those for patients with multiple Th2-associated diseases. Personalized therapeutic strategies for initial and maintenance treatments of EoE must be rationally designed, to reduce the burden of disease and answer meaningfully the needs of all stakeholders involved in EoE.

Update review of pain control methods of tonsil surgery.
Kim, DH, Jang, K, Lee, S, Lee, HJ
Auris, nasus, larynx. 2020;(1):42-47
Abstract
Pain after tonsil surgery is troublesome because it causes discomfort. In addition, handling patients with postoperative pain is challenging to otolaryngologists. Many laboratory studies have assessed the use of analgesics and surgical techniques to discover methods for effective control of postoperative pain associated with tonsil surgery. In this review article, we summarize and provide a comprehensive overview of current methods for the control of pain after tonsil surgery based on findings of recent studies. Although powered intracapsular tonsillotomy is not popular yet, it seems to be an effective option among various surgical techniques. More discussion about powered intracapsular tonsillotomy should be done in the future. On the other hand, surgery with a harmonic scalpel, fibrin glue, or cryoanalgesia seems ineffective. When reviewing medical treatment methods, the use of nonsteroidal anti-inflammatory drugs, steroids, and/or gabapentin/pregabalin seems to be effective. However, the use of opioid (especially codeine) for children should be avoided because of possible respiratory insufficiency. Ketorolac is dangerous because of the risk of hemorrhage. We should continue to focus on the development of novel postoperative pain control techniques with no or low complications.

Antenatal Corticosteroids and Magnesium Sulfate for Improved Preterm Neonatal Outcomes: A Review of Guidelines.
Tsakiridis, I, Mamopoulos, A, Athanasiadis, A, Dagklis, T
Obstetrical & gynecological survey. 2020;(5):298-307
Abstract
IMPORTANCE In cases of anticipated preterm delivery, corticosteroids for fetal lung maturation and magnesium sulfate for fetal neuroprotection may improve neonatal outcomes. OBJECTIVE The aim of this study was to summarize and compare published guidelines from 4 leading medical societies on the administration of antenatal corticosteroids and magnesium sulfate. EVIDENCE ACQUISITION A descriptive review of major national guidelines on corticosteroids and magnesium sulfate was conducted: National Institute for Health and Care Excellence on "Preterm labour and birth," World Health Organization on "WHO recommendations on interventions to improve preterm birth outcomes," American College of Obstetricians and Gynecologists on "Antenatal corticosteroid therapy for fetal maturation" and "Magnesium sulfate use in obstetrics," and Society of Obstetricians and Gynecologists of Canada on "Antenatal corticosteroid therapy for improving neonatal outcomes" and "Magnesium sulphate for fetal neuroprotection." RESULTS A variation in the appropriate timing of administration exists, whereas repeated courses are not routinely recommended for corticosteroids or magnesium sulfate. In addition, the recommendations are the same for singleton and multiple gestations, and no specific recommendation exists according to maternal body mass index. Finally, a variation in guidelines regarding the administration of corticosteroids before cesarean delivery exists. CONCLUSION The adoption of an international consensus on corticosteroids and magnesium sulfate may increase their endorsement by health care professionals, leading to more favorable neonatal outcomes after preterm delivery.

Diagnosis and treatment of eosinophilic esophagitis.
Gonsalves, NP, Aceves, SS
The Journal of allergy and clinical immunology. 2020;(1):1-7
-
-
Free full text
-
Abstract
Eosinophilic esophagitis (EoE) is an eosinophil-rich, TH2 antigen-mediated disease of increasing pediatric and adult worldwide prevalence. Diagnosis requires greater than or equal to 15 eosinophils per high-power field on light microscopy. Symptoms reflect esophageal dysfunction, and typical endoscopic features include linear furrows, white plaques, and concentric rings. Progressive disease leads to pathologic tissue remodeling, with ensuing esophageal rigidity and loss of luminal diameter caused by strictures. Therapies include proton pump inhibitors, elimination diets, and topical corticosteroids. Effective treatment can reverse tissue fibrosis in some patients, as well as decrease the rate of food impactions. Esophageal dilation might be required to increase luminal patency. The chronic nature of EoE necessitates long-term therapy to avoid disease recurrence and complications. This review serves the function of providing the current state-of-the-art diagnostic criteria and disease management for adult and pediatric EoE.

Management of Eosinophilic Esophagitis: Dietary and Nondietary Approaches.
Chen, JW
Nutrition in clinical practice : official publication of the American Society for Parenteral and Enteral Nutrition. 2020;(5):835-847
-
-
Free full text
-
Abstract
Eosinophilic esophagitis (EoE) is an allergen-driven chronic inflammatory condition, characterized by symptoms related to esophageal dysfunction and confirmed histologically by esophageal mucosal eosinophilia. Since its first description in the 1990s, the incidence and prevalence of EoE have been on the rise. It is known to affect all ages of various ethnic backgrounds and both sexes; however, it is most seen in White males. Children with EoE often present with abdominal pain, nausea, vomiting, and failure to thrive, whereas adults with EoE typically present with dysphagia and food impaction. Diagnosis of EoE requires histologic confirmation of elevated esophageal eosinophils in a symptomatic patient, and only after secondary causes have been excluded. Because EoE is a chronic and progressively fibrostenotic disease, treatment goals include resolution of symptoms, induction and maintenance of disease remission, and prevention and possibly reversal of fibrostenotic complications, while minimizing treatment-related adverse effects and improving quality of life. Treatment strategies include the "3 D's"-drugs, diet, and dilation. Standard drug therapies include proton-pump inhibitors and topical corticosteroids. Dietary therapies include elemental diet, allergy testing-directed elimination diet, and empiric elimination diets. Endoscopic esophageal dilation for EoE strictures can alleviate esophageal symptoms but has no effect on mucosal inflammation. Recent progress in EoE research has made possible evidence-based clinical guidelines. Ongoing pharmacologic trials show promise for novel biologic agents in the treatment of refractory EoE.
